When you drive south from Kuching, you will soon be in the rural countryside of the Padawan. This is the region where the Bedayu live, no longer in longhouses, but in attractive kampungs. One of these is Kg Sadir, on the slopes of the Penrissen range. There are several waterfalls near this kampung.
There are at least three waterfalls near this kampung and we had decided first to visit the tallest one, Ban Buan Kukuot. A friendly villager gave us directions how to reach this fall, and we started trekking. The paths are well kept, because they lead to the hill-padi fields. However, we must have missed a junction somwehere, because we were not able to find the fall. So we went back to the kampung and talked with a local. He told us that there are so many trails, it is better to use a guide.
After many hours of unsuccessful trekking it was sheer pleasure to take a refreshing bath here. The fall is almost vertical, so you can take a nice shower here.
It is clear that we will have to come back here, to explore the other falls.
